I personally have not had any work done at this dental clinic, but my wife has. She has almost a full partial and was very happy with the doctor and the costs. This dentist is well known in the Chiang Mai community and is very busy - so get an appointment.

I do not know if he speaks English, but maybe enough to get by.

It's the WORRAPONJ DENTAL CLINIC

74/1 Ratchiangsoen Rd

053 282 939 or 053 208 777 open from 9 a.m. till 8 p.m.

I believe he has one or two other doctors on staff, so ask for him specifically.

The reason I am recommending this clinic is because they have a detal lab on premises which makes the turn around time minimal. Other clinics have to send their work out to various labs which delays things.

My wife kept asking him to make a new partial, three times he told her, NO, the ones you have are still good and that what she has - you can't get any better. Her's were made in the USA - top quality. He told her, "you don't need to spend any money"

I've had bad experience at both.

Grace did the present set of false teeth (which I'm looking to replace). She didn't wait long enough for the gums to heal following extraction hence thew fit is now loose, and the length/line is too short hence they are barely visible even with a big smile, other problem too...

I was probably unlucky; but it would be silly, awkward and futile - to go back there for the same thing. (It's not as if there's the remotest chance she's going to admit her botch up and do me a new set for free.

But I'm not necessarily warning you off Grace

Dental Hospital (where I'd gone before switching to Grace) - the old man (owner I believe) made a complete balls up of a treatment...wont bore you with the details.
